Xu Qing joins LOOPER
With everyone at a loss for words talking about the upcoming Rian Johnson sci-fi time travel action film, LOOPER, especially after it was revealed to feature effects work done by time travel deity Shane Carruth (director of PRIMER), the cast just got a lot more interesting as well.
THR is reporting that Chinese actress Xu Qing has joined the film’s cast, which begins shooting next week. The film already stars Joseph Gordon-Levitt, Bruce Willis, Paul Dano, and Emily Blunt, and is set in a world “sixty years from now where China is the leading super power and time travel has been invented.” The film was originally set to be set in France, but it appears as though Johnson has simply rewritten the script, to accommodate the film’s production, which is being backed by Beijing advertising/film production firm, DMG.
